    Abstract: A chassis (1) for a motor vehicle has an electrical axle (2) with two electrical machines (4) for respectively driving two wheels (6). The chassis (1) also has a step-down gear mechanism (10, 11) arranged between the respective electrical machine and the associated wheel. Each step-down gear mechanism is connected to the respective wheel by a cardan shaft. The respective rotation axes (5, 5) of the two electrical machines are arranged parallel and next to one another. The chassis enables each wheel to be mounted in a non-rigid manner and permits the overall length of the electrical machines to be varied on account of the arrangement of the rotation axes of the electrical machines.

    Abstract: A drive apparatus (1) for a motor vehicle has a hollow portal axle (2) that accommodates two electrical machines (4). Wheels (12) are mounted rotatably at opposite ends of the portal axle (2) and can be driven by the electrical machine (4) associated with the respective wheel. A step-down gear mechanism (8, 9) is arranged between each electrical machine (4) and the respective wheel (12) and a separate connection from the respective wheel to the step-down gear mechanism, permits the wheel to be mounted in a non-rigid manner. The respective step-down gear mechanism (8, 9) is connected to the respective wheel (12) by a cardan shaft (10).

    Abstract: An oil supply system for an internal combustion engine includes an oil pump, a heat exchanger, an oil feed line and two oil outlet lines, for conveying the oil from the oil pump through the oil feed line to the heat exchanger and from the latter through the two oil outlet lines. In a system of this type, there is provision for the internal combustion engine to be configured as a piston engine and for the heat exchanger to be configured as a water/oil heat exchanger, and for one oil outlet line to be connected to oil spray nozzles of the piston engine and for the other oil outlet line to be connected to a main oil line of the piston engine. An oil supply system of this type is distinguished by its simple design and functionality, and permits optimum cooling and lubrication of the relevant components of the engine.

    Abstract: The present invention relates to an improved multi-step method for preparing an extract from ginkgo biloba having a reduced content of 4?-O-methyl pyridoxine and/or biflavones, wherein the depletion is carried out by filtration over an adsorber resin and/or an ion exchanger and the substances to be removed are retained on the resin. The invention further relates to an extract from ginkgo biloba having a reduced content of 4?-O-methyl pyridoxine and/or biflavones, which is obtainable by the method according to the present invention, as well as to its use.

    Abstract: A regulatable coolant pump and a method for regulation of this regulatable coolant pump for internal combustion engines, which is driven by way of a pulley actives a valve slide using an electromagnetically activated piston pump equipped with a return spring in the form of a pressure spring. The pump implements a “pump feed” using many small “partial lifts.” A “leakage volume stream” that flows opposite to the “pumped volume stream” is superimposed on the “pumped volume stream” via the arrangement of circular apertures both in the inlet valve membrane of the working piston and in the outlet valve membrane so that the valve slide can be moved in defined manner and in a very robust and reliable manner, with low drive power via the defined superimposition of these two volume streams.
